Output 9c9506a7aba5cfa6ba3521dd9f8848e1556a0de3decd3b6a186ebab39584bec1:21

value
132876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77c820c685df201afd326e37f571de77ee6b3df5 OP_EQUAL
address
3CcN5WaeG3eZRpZVf3UtbYQhs5YFA9uBPH
transaction
9c9506a7aba5cfa6ba3521dd9f8848e1556a0de3decd3b6a186ebab39584bec1
spent
true